For the 2025-26 school year, there are 6 private preschools serving 643 students in Cheshire County, NH.
The top ranked private preschools in Cheshire County, NH include St. Joseph Regional School, Dublin Christian Academy, and Trinity Christian School.
The average acceptance rate is 87%, which is higher than the New Hampshire private preschool average acceptance rate of 76%.
50% of private preschools in Cheshire County, NH are religiously affiliated (most commonly Lutheran Church Missouri Synod and Christian).
